This review is from: My Baby Can Talk - First Signs Board Book (Board book)
We got this for our daughter when she was about 9 months old. She had the "My Baby Can Talk" videos and loves them, and it seemed a good way to reinforce the signing. It was especially good when she was in childcare, because nursery staff who didn't know the signs could read her the book (not much to ask really!) and learn the signs, while reinforcing what she already knew.

One of the things I really like about these books, which other signing books don't seem to have is little rhymes that explain the sign. Other books show you the sign, but there is nothing to read. Examples from the book: "Taking a bath is what I like best, The sign for a bath is washing your chest" or "My little socks are comfy and new, With fingers together I pretend to knit two". With pictures of the item (socks) and a drawn picture of a little girl doing the sign. So it is like reading a nursery rhyme AND learning the sign.

My daughter is now just over 2yrs and I can't stress enough how great signing as been for her. She rarely has tantrums, because she can express what she wants. When she does have a tantrum they last about a minute, while I remind her use her words or her signs to tell us what she wants. And her language ability is far ahead of the other kids her age, I think just because she learned so much earlier that things have names... and now she wants the name for everything!

This review is from: My Baby Can Talk - First Signs Board Book (Board book)
Book is a nice size for a small child to hold and has good color photos of both the subject being signed and a child signing. I like the book, but 75% of the signs are animals. I was hoping for more daily use signs (as the book is called "First Signs"), we just don't see a lot of horses and ducks during our day. My 3 year old only communicates through sign and he does like to look through this book.
